What is the best way to mount a GPS 5 on the 12R?
Just received my GPS 5 and am looking at how to mount it. Any suggestions are welcomed. Pics would be great also. Thanks, Ozzy.

I mounted mine with a sheet of industrial velcro (2"x4")& the swivel mount that comes with the GPS 5. I mounted it just left of the ignition key switch on the flat part of the top triple clamp. I also hard wired it. Works great! GPS is awesome!
